IT is with dismay that I read yet another misleading advert from Unison in the Welsh press. The union paid for adverts in media criticising "the Government's plans" on the involvement of private firms in healthcare.

A valid debate — in England.

The UK Government's approach to health has absolutely nothing to do with Wales. Whatsoever.

Health is a devolved issue and it is a fact that the Welsh Government is cutting our NHS budget by almost half a billion pounds.
